Coffeehouse Chronicles #183: An Afternoon with Agosto Machado

Saturday, May 30, 20263:00 PM
Coffeehouse Chronicles is an educational performance series exploring the history of Off-Off Broadway, featuring firsthand oral accounts from artists and conversations with contemporary artists.

La MaMa Experimental Theatre Club

A cornerstone of the East Village, this venue has established a long-standing reputation for supporting innovative artists and unconventional theatrical-scale productions. It serves as a home for experimental plays and musicals that explore deep cultural themes.story_potoo
